ChipMOS May revenue up nearly 18% Y/Y

Why this matters
Why now

The reported revenue increase reflects continued robust demand for semiconductor testing and assembly services, indicative of the current growth phase in the broader chip industry.

Why it’s important

This indicates strong operational performance for a key player in the semiconductor supply chain, impacting investor sentiment and providing insights into the health of downstream tech sectors.

What changes

The positive revenue trend for ChipMOS suggests sustained momentum in certain segments of the semiconductor industry, potentially driving investment decisions and resource allocation.
